Overview
S25FS064SAGMFB010 from Infineon is a 64 Mb (8 MB) serial NOR flash memory IC with SPI Multi-I/O interface, 1.8 V single-supply operation, and industrial temperature range (–40°C to +85°C). It supports DDR Quad I/O read at 80 MHz (80 MBps), 256/512-byte page programming, hardware ECC, hybrid/uniform sector erase, and AEC-Q100 Grade 3 automotive qualification. Used in boot code storage for microcontrollers in industrial control systems.
For engineers reviewing the S25FS064SAGMFB010 datasheet, S25FS064SAGMFB010 pinout, S25FS064SAGMFB010 application, or S25FS064SAGMFB010 equivalent, key selection criteria include SPI-MIO timing compliance, 1.7–2.0 V supply tolerance, 100,000 program-erase cycles, SFDP/CFI configuration support, and OTP array security for firmware integrity.
Technical Context
This device implements Infineon's 65-nm MIRRORBIT™ technology with ECLIPSE architecture, enabling high-density nonvolatile storage with embedded hardware ECC for single-bit error correction and automatic recovery. Its dual-mode SPI interface supports both legacy SDR and DDR protocols, with QPI mode for quad-parallel command/address/data transfer.
The memory array is organized with configurable sector options: eight 4 KB + one 32 KB sectors (hybrid) or uniform 64 KB/256 KB blocks. Erase and program suspend/resume functions enable real-time system responsiveness during background flash operations.

FAQ
What is the maximum DDR Quad I/O read speed supported by S25FS064SAGMFB010?
The device supports DDR Quad I/O read at 80 MHz, delivering 80 MBps throughput. This is confirmed in Table 1 of the official Infineon datasheet (002-03631 Rev. *I), where DDR Quad I/O Read is explicitly rated at 80 MBps. The 80 MHz clock frequency is the maximum validated for DDR mode; exceeding it risks timing violations and data corruption.
Does S25FS064SAGMFB010 support both hybrid and uniform sector erase configurations?
Yes, it supports two configurable sector architectures: hybrid (eight 4 KB + one 32 KB sectors at top/bottom) and uniform (all 64 KB or all 256 KB sectors). This is selectable via status register bits and documented in Section 6.1 and Table 6 of the datasheet. The hybrid option enables flexible partitioning for bootloader and application code.
Is the OTP array accessible after initial programming?
The 1024-byte OTP array can be programmed once per byte; subsequent writes to already-programmed locations are ignored. Read access remains unrestricted. This behavior is defined in Section 4.5.4 of the datasheet and enforced by on-die logic-no software lock or fuse blowing is required beyond standard write commands.
